Abstract

The main reason for applying microclimate control in greenhouses is to achieve optimal growing environment. Because of its complexity, excessive control in greenhouses can adversely affect the cultivation of crops. Moreover, we have optimum control to achieve these challenging goals, including lower emissions and reduced production costs. The most important stage in the research of algorithms of management of technological objects is to develop a model of the object, which reflects the processes occurring in the object. Typical solutions for managing objects are based on simple models, operating with abstract parameters. Such models, in connection with the abstract nature of the parameters do not allow in-depth study and changes in the characteristics of the object. For more in-depth research and synthesis of automatic control systems of interest are models that reveal the physical basis of operation of the facility. This article describes a practical approach aboutgreenhouse control system
